For these variables below,
unsigned m_schemeEnd : 26;
unsigned m_userStart;
m_userStart == m_schemeEnd + 1
this comparison emits a compiler warning as below.
warning: comparison of integer expressions of different signedness: ‘unsigned
int’ and ‘int’ [-Wsign-compare]
This bug was found during WebKit gtk port build with gcc 9.3.0.
Temporarily, this warning was removed by this patch,
https://trac.webkit.org/changeset/260715/webkit
like
bool slashSlashNeeded = m_userStart == static_cast<unsigned>(m_schemeEnd + 1);
but we think that this bug should be fixed in gcc.
